Transaction aec33af8202e914d371f5d539b4d6ce415395b074f74c53bbbdcddfefd787022

2 Input
1 Outputs
  • aec33af8202e914d371f5d539b4d6ce415395b074f74c53bbbdcddfefd787022:0
  • value  546876
    address  1KwCNw8fnXvTPjV8T1xCCEJX8sEYjjxcEL